BETTER TIMES FOR TEACHERS
HON. JAS. ALLEN'S PROMISE. (Feb Pusss Association.j AKAROA. March 4. Hon. J as. Allen, Minister for Education, opening the new school at Akaroa this afteriie m. said he intended next session to give further consideration to salaries pai,! to school teachers, lie hoped to make things better fro them not only in the primary schools but also in the secondary schools, for his opinion was that teachers in the latter schools were very much underpaid, and i.e hoped to make their position more comfortable.
